President Trump will address supporters at a campaign rally in Fayetteville, North Carolina, at 7 p.m. EST.
The rally is being held in the Crown Expo Center, which can hold about 7,000 people.
Trump is speaking a day before voters in North Carolina's 9th Congressional District are casting ballots in a special election called by the North Carolina Board of Elections over issues with absentee ballots. The president has endorsed state Sen. Dan Bishop for the race.
